~>When a democracy is OVERTHROWN by the MILITARY
~>The people of that country are deprived of many freedoms. 
~>FIRST of all, they lose the freedom of speech and expression and cannot say anything against the military government. 
~>Secondly, they are not allowed to form political parties and workers union. 
~>Thirdly, the people are deprived of their right to choose their own leaders, or to CHANGE them. 
~>After the military Coup in Chile led by General Pinochet the people of Chile were denied all these above mentioned rights...
